Harvey's CEO Shares Key Strategies for Scaling His $5 Billion Legal AI Startup

Winston Weinberg, the CEO of Harvey, has revealed two critical habits that are propelling the growth of his $5 billion legal AI startup. In a recent discussion, Weinberg emphasized the importance of conducting regular calendar audits and implementing a hands-on approach to hiring.

Calendar audits allow the team to assess how time is being allocated across various projects and tasks, ensuring that resources are used efficiently. This practice not only helps in identifying bottlenecks but also fosters a culture of accountability within the organization.

On the hiring front, Weinberg believes that a personal touch is essential. By being directly involved in the recruitment process, he ensures that new hires align with the company’s vision and values. This approach not only strengthens the team but also enhances the overall workplace culture, ultimately contributing to the startup's rapid growth and success in the competitive legal tech industry.
